What does this implement/fix?

An LLDB synthetic child provider was implemented, with which the LLDB debugger can show the items in a structured view.

This script supports fixed or dynamic storage dense matrix, and compressed or uncompressed sparse matrix. Both row-major or column-major matrices are supported.

Usage

Import the script to LLDB using the following command

command script import eigenlldb.py

The effects in command line on Ubuntu 20.04 with LLDB 10:

(lldb) frame variable vector3
(Eigen::Vector3d) vector3 = ([0,0] = 1, [1,0] = 1, [2,0] = 1)
(lldb) frame variable matrix3
(Eigen::Matrix3d) matrix3 = ([0,0] = 1, [1,0] = 1, [2,0] = 1, [0,1] = 1, [1,1] = 1, [2,1] = 1, [0,2] = 1, [1,2] = 1, [2,2] = 1)
(lldb) frame variable sparse_mat
(Eigen::SparseMatrix<double, 0, int>) sparse_mat = ([0,0] = 1, [0,1] = 2, [1,1] = 3)
